Chiefs will have Mansoor Delane at Wednesday’s practice

Word on Tuesday was that Chiefs cornerback Mansoor Delane avoided a serious shoulder injury in Monday night’s win over the Broncos and the first-round pick is set to be back on the field right away.

Chiefs head coach Andy Reid told reporters at a Wednesday press conference that Delane will take part in their first practice of the week. Delane intercepted Broncos quarterback Bo Nix on the third play on Monday night, but came down on his shoulder and did not return. Delane also dealt with a shoulder issue in the offseason.

Reid said that offensive tackle Josh Simmons (back) and defensive back Chamarri Conner (knee) will remain out of practice. They were both inactive for the win over Denver.

Linebacker Cooper McDonald (knee) will also miss practice and Reid said he will be placed on injured reserve.
